Following Hana Kimura’s death, the current season of Terrace House: Tokyo has been canceled.
The outlet also reported at the time that Kimura had posted several troubling tweets, which had since been deleted. A cause of death has not yet been officially released.
Kimura came from a wrestling family, as the daughter of pro wrestler Kyoko Kimura.
